www.medgyessy.hu/indexflash.php

and then click to the flash, written Bele'pe's on it.

Problem: It calls MM_openBrWindow, which, in fact, is defined. However,
the javascript console reports: Error: MM_openBrWindow is not defined.

Result: since Bele'pe's in Hungarian means Enter, one cannot
enter the page... And I found the same problem with a couple of other
pages, and while flash gains popularity, the problem becomes more and
more serious.
